Abstract

This paper is aimed at characterization of multipath propagation in land mobile satellite scenarios. Of particular interest is the average multipath power coming from scattering of electromagnetic waves from rough building surface. Method of physical optics was implemented to model scattering from rough building facades. The results in terms of time series of the received power are used to obtain statistics of multipath power for various roughness parameters of the building faccedilade and various elevations and azimuths of the transmitter. The results obtained can be used to predict signal propagation in urban environments or as input data to time series generating models.
